When Your Rival Gives “Advice”: Would You Marry Me Turns Up the Drama

Reetam Bodhak by Reetam Bodhak
October 31, 2025
in Entertainment, FAQ, News, News, Recent News, Social Media, Web Series
0

The romantic tension in SBS’s hit rom-com “Would You Marry Me” just got brutally honest. Jung So Min’s character faces an uncomfortable confrontation with romantic rival Shin Seul Ki, whose “advice” promises to shake up the fake marriage that’s becoming all too real.

Would You Marry Me Drama Info

DetailInformation
NetworkSBS (Disney+ streaming)
Premiere DateOctober 10, 2025
Finale DateNovember 15, 2025
Episodes12 (70 minutes each)
ScheduleFriday & Saturday, 9:50 PM KST
Rating8.1/10 (MyDramaList)
GenreRomantic Comedy, Family Drama

The Love Triangle Nobody Wanted

At the heart of this confrontation lies a classic K-drama dilemma: childhood friend versus first love. Shin Seul Ki portrays Yoon Jin Kyung, Kim Woo Joo’s longtime childhood friend who secretly harbors feelings for him. After learning that Yoo Mary (Jung So Min) is actually his first love from years ago, Jin Kyung’s hidden emotions surface.

The October 31 episode promises an awkward face-to-face between the two women competing for Woo Joo’s affection. Preview stills show Mary looking visibly uncomfortable, keeping her hands tightly clasped and avoiding eye contact, while Jin Kyung glares resentfully with a piercing gaze and displeased frown.

The Brutal Advice That Changes Everything

Jin Kyung offers Mary “brutal advice that hits her where it hurts,” according to preview information. While specific dialogue remains under wraps, this confrontation could expose the fragility of Mary’s fake marriage arrangement or challenge her worthiness as Woo Joo’s partner.

The timing couldn’t be worse—just as Mary and Woo Joo’s contract relationship starts developing genuine feelings, Jin Kyung’s words threaten to undermine Mary’s confidence.

Understanding the Core Premise

“Would You Marry Me” follows Yoo Mary, a small business owner who needs cooperation from Kim Woo Joo, heir to South Korea’s oldest bakery, to claim a luxurious newlywed home she won in a lottery. Their 90-day fake marriage creates the perfect setup for rom-com chaos.

Choi Woo Shik stars as Kim Woo Joo, bringing his trademark warmth from “Our Beloved Summer” to this perfectionist bakery heir character. His chemistry with Jung So Min has become the drama’s biggest draw, earning praise from viewers worldwide.

Why This Confrontation Matters

Romantic rivals in K-dramas typically follow one of two paths: petty villainy or graceful acceptance. Jin Kyung’s “brutal honesty” approach suggests something more complex—she might expose uncomfortable truths Mary needs to hear, even if delivered with resentment.

This confrontation could serve multiple narrative purposes:

  • Reality Check: Reminding Mary that her marriage is contractual, not real
  • Emotional Catalyst: Forcing Mary to examine her growing feelings
  • Character Development: Showing Jin Kyung’s perspective beyond jealousy
  • Plot Acceleration: Creating the crisis needed for the third-act resolution

The Childhood Friend Dilemma

Jin Kyung represents the K-drama archetype of the childhood friend who “deserves” the male lead due to history and loyalty. Her secret crush on Woo Joo positions her as someone who’s “earned” his affection through years of friendship.

However, Woo Joo telling Jin Kyung that Mary is his first love from long ago complicates this dynamic. First love versus childhood friend becomes a battle of depth versus duration—which emotional connection matters more?

Viewer Reception and Ratings

The drama’s 8.1 rating on MyDramaList reflects strong positive reception, with viewers particularly praising the lead chemistry and fresh take on the fake marriage trope. The ex-fiancé subplot has divided audiences, but Mary and Woo Joo’s relationship remains the compelling core.

Early episode binges suggest addictive quality—multiple viewers reported watching all available episodes in single sittings, testament to the show’s engaging pacing and emotional hooks.

What’s at Stake

This confrontation arrives midway through the series’ 12-episode run, perfectly timed for maximum dramatic impact. Mary’s response to Jin Kyung’s harsh truths will likely determine whether she fights for her developing relationship or retreats into self-doubt.

The fake marriage premise works because genuine feelings complicate the arrangement. Jin Kyung’s intervention threatens to make Mary question whether her feelings are reciprocated or if she’s simply convenient for Woo Joo’s purposes.

The Broader Narrative Arc

Beyond individual characters, this rivalry reflects the drama’s exploration of authentic versus performed relationships. Mary literally performs marriage for 90 days, while Jin Kyung performs friendship while hiding romantic feelings. Both women wear masks—whose will crack first?

FAQs

Q: Is the rivalry between Jin Kyung and Mary the main conflict in Would You Marry Me?

A: No, the romantic rivalry is a subplot within the larger story. The main conflict centers on Mary and Woo Joo’s fake marriage arrangement, Mary’s financial struggles following her broken engagement, and both characters confronting their pasts. Jin Kyung’s character adds complexity to the love story but doesn’t overshadow the core fake-marriage-turns-real premise. The drama balances multiple conflicts including Mary’s ex-fiancé, family business pressures, and the 90-day deadline for proving their marriage is legitimate.

Q: Does Jin Kyung become a villain in the drama?

A: Based on viewer reactions and previews, Jin Kyung appears to be portrayed with nuance rather than as a one-dimensional villain. While she clearly resents Mary and delivers harsh advice, her character represents the pain of unrequited love and longtime friendship. The drama seems to acknowledge her perspective even while favoring the main couple. Shin Seul Ki’s acclaimed performance brings depth to a character that could easily become clichéd, making Jin Kyung sympathetic despite being an obstacle to the central romance.
